Saudi clubs dominate the list of highest market values in the Elite Asia Champions League, with a total combined value of 870.7 million euros, surpassing a billion euros when including all participating teams. Leading the chart is Al Hilal with a market value of 239.8 million euros, followed by Al Ahli at 193.9 million, then Al Qadsiah at 152.3 million, Al Ittihad at 148.2 million, and Al Nassr at 136.5 million. The tournament features 16 clubs from the West and 16 from the East, after increasing the number of teams to 32, with prize money reaching up to 12 million dollars for the winner and 6 million for the runner-up. The group stage begins in March, with the finals scheduled for April in Saudi Arabia. The Saudi club Al Ahli is eager to defend its title, opening their campaign against Uzbekistan's Pakhtakor.
